/* CSS Document */

body{margin:0;padding:0;text-align:center;  background:url(../images/bg.gif) repeat-x;}
h1,h2,h3,h4,h5,h6,a,div,span,p,ul,li,form,label,img,input,select,textarea{margin:0;padding:0;font-family: "trebuchet MS";font-weight:normal; }
h1 { font-size:30px; padding:0px 0px 20px 0px;}
.home_h1 { display:none;}
.article_h1 { color:#c89a8d;}
.float_left { float:left;}
.yellow_text { color:#c89a8d;}
.blue_text { color:#c89a8d;}
.red_text { color:#c89a8d;}
.green_text { color:#c89a8d;}
.brown_text  { color:#c89a8d;}
.pink_text {  color:#c89a8d;}
.container { width:890px; position:relative; margin:0 auto; text-align:left;}
.main_content { padding-top:170px;}
.banner { margin-bottom:20px; padding-left:3px;}
.header { position:absolute; top:0px; left:0px; width:100%;}
.header img { float:left; border:none; margin-top:20px;}

/*navigation*/
.nav{position:absolute;top:116px; left:0px; width:100%;}
.nav ul  { list-style-type:none;}
.nav li{float:left;margin:0 2px;background: url(../images/curve_right_normal.gif) right top no-repeat;filter:alpha(opacity=90);opacity:0.90; }
.nav li a{font-size:14px;text-decoration:none;color:#666666;background:url(../images/curve_left_normal.gif) left top no-repeat;padding:6px 21px;display:block; color:#6f645c;}
.nav li:hover{filter:alpha(opacity=800);opacity:0.8; color:#6f645c;}
.nav li.active{filter:alpha(opacity=100);opacity:1; background:#ffffff url(../images/curve_right.gif) right top no-repeat; }.nav li.active a{color:#bf746c;cursor:default;background:url(../images/curve_left.gif) left top no-repeat;}.nav li a:hover{color:#6f645c!important;}
.blank{display:block;height:1px; width:1px;float:left;}


.article { width:530px; float:right; padding-right:30px;  _padding-right:23px; padding-bottom:50px;}
.article p { margin-bottom:20px; color:#222; font-size:15px;}
.article ul { padding:0 20px 20px 20px; color:#000000;}
.article img { float:right;}

.left_ads { position:relative; width:270px; height:240px!important; display:block; float:left; padding:5px 0px 50px 10px;}
.left_ads ul { list-style-type:none; padding-top:15px;}
.left_ads ul li { padding:5px 0px 12px 0px; cursor:pointer;}
.left_ads ul li a { color:#333; font-size:15px; text-decoration:none; cursor:pointer; font-weight:bold;}
.left_ads a:hover { text-decoration:underline;}
.left_ads ul li a p { color:#666; font-size:13px;}
.left_ads span { color:#ccc; font-size:12px; position:absolute; top:0px; left:180px;}




.logo_ads {  width:270px;  display:block; float:left; padding:40px 0px 50px 20px; position:relative;}
.logo_ads ul { list-style-type:none;}
.logo_ads ul li { padding:5px 0px 30px 0px;}
.logo_ads img { clear:both; display:block; border:none;}
.logo_ads ul li a { color:#333; font-size:13px; font-weight:bold; text-decoration:none; cursor:pointer;}
.logo_ads li:hover a { text-decoration:underline;}
.logo_ads ul li a p { color:#666; font-size:13px; height:40px;}
.logo_ads span { color:#ccc; font-size:12px; position:absolute; top:20px; left:200px;}



.footer { width:100%; margin:0px; padding:0px; display:block; clear:both; padding-top:80px!important; padding-bottom:40px; height:250px; background-color:#f4f0ef;}
.f_inner{width:980px;text-align:left;margin:0 auto;  position:relative;}
.fnav{float:left;width:800px;margin:0 0 0 10px;}
.fnav ul { list-style-type:none;}
.fnav ul li{float:left;line-height:16px;width:230px; height:100px} .fnav ul li ul{float:left;clear:both; width:240px;margin:0;height:100px;} .fnav ul li ul li{float:left;clear:both;}
.fnav ul li a{color:#666666;text-decoration:none;font-weight:bold;} 
.fnav ul li ul li a{color:#666666;text-decoration:none;font-weight:normal;font-size:13px;} 
.fnav ul li ul li a:hover{color:#000; text-decoration:underline;} 

.footer_logo { width:200px; height:100px; position:absolute; top:-5px; left:780px;}
.footer_logo p { text-align:left; font-size:13px; color:#666666;}
.footer_logo a { color:#333;}




.long_links { width:550px; padding-top:10px;}
.long_links span{ font-size:12px; color:#999; padding-left:15px; display:none; /*position:absolute; top:4px; left:400px;*/}
.long_links ul { list-style-type:disc; color:#769999; padding-left:20px; padding-bottom:5px;}
.long_links li { padding:4px 0px 8px 0px;}
.long_links p { padding:0px; margin:0px; color:#666; font-size:13px;}
.long_links li a{ font-size:15px; font-style:normal; font-weight:bold; color:#333; padding-left:0px; text-decoration:none;}
.long_links li a:hover { text-decoration:underline;}
.long_links li strong { color:#555;}
.long_links h2 { font-size:22px;}
.long_links h3 { font-size:22px;}




.short_links {  width:270px; padding:10px 0px 40px 10px;}
.short_links span{ font-size:12px; color:#999; padding-left:15px; position:absolute; top:4px; left:400px;}
.short_links ul { list-style-type:none; color:#769999; padding-bottom:5px;}
.short_links li { padding:4px 0px 15px 0px;}
.short_links p { padding:0px; margin:0px; color:#666; font-size:13px;}
.short_links li a{ font-size:13px; font-style:normal; font-weight:bold; color:#333; padding-left:0px; text-decoration:none;}
.short_links li a:hover { text-decoration:underline;}
.short_links li strong { color:#555;}
.short_links h2 { font-size:22px;}
.short_links h3 { font-size:22px;}





.article_spon { position:relative; width:300px; padding:30px 10px;}
.article_spon span{ font-size:12px; color:#999; padding-left:15px; /*position:absolute; top:4px; left:400px;*/}
.article_spon ul { list-style-type:disc; color:#FFCC33; padding-left:15px; padding-bottom:5px;}
.article_spon li { padding:4px 0px 8px 0px;}
.article_spon p { padding:0px; margin:0px; color:#666; font-size:13px;}
.article_spon li a{ font-size:13px; font-style:normal; font-weight:bold; color:#333; padding-left:0px; text-decoration:none;}
.article_spon li a:hover { text-decoration:underline;}
.article_spon li strong { color:#555;}



.sub { filter:alpha(opacity=80);opacity:0.8;  width:460px; padding:40px 30px; margin:5px 0 15px 0; cursor:pointer; background:url(../images/sub_bg.gif) top left no-repeat; text-align:center; }
.sub a { text-decoration:none;}
.sub a:hover { text-decoration:underline; color:#999;}
.sub:hover {filter:alpha(opacity=100);opacity:1;}

.article_main_content { padding-top:170px;}

.article_ads { float:right; width:300px; height:60px; padding:180px 20px 20px 20px; margin-bottom:10px;}
.article_ads span { font-size:12px; color:#999;}
.article_ads a { font-size:13px; color:#333; text-decoration:none;}
.article_ads p { font-size:13px; color:#666; padding:3px 0px 0px 0px;}
.article_ads a:hover p{ color:#444; text-decoration:underline;}
.ads1 { background:url(../images/illustration_01.jpg) top left no-repeat;}
.ads2 { background:url(../images/illustration_02.jpg) top left no-repeat;}
.ads3 { background:url(../images/illustration_03.jpg) top left no-repeat;}
.ads4 { background:url(../images/illustration_04.jpg) top left no-repeat;}
.ads5 { background:url(../images/illustration_05.jpg) top left no-repeat;}

.bread { padding:10px 0px 20px 0px; font-size:12px; }
.bread a { color:#999;}



#div_advertise form p { width:400px; display:block; padding:5px 0px;}
#div_advertise form p span { width:90px; display:block; float:left; height:25px;}
#div_advertise form input.text, #div_advertise form textarea {   clear:both; display:block;background:#FFF; border:1px #999 solid; padding:3px; width:260px; font-size:13px;}
#div_advertise a { float:left;}
#div_advertise img { float:left;}
#div_advertise .sub2 { padding:5px 15px; background-color:#3399CC; color:#FFFFFF; font-weight:bold; font:13px; border:none; margin:10px 0px; cursor:pointer;}
#div_advertise .sub2:hover { background:#FF3300;}


#contact_us form p { width:400px; display:block; padding:5px 0px;}
#contact_us form p span { width:90px; display:block; float:left; height:25px;}
#contact_us form input.text, #contact_us form textarea, #contact_us form select {   clear:both; display:block;background:#FFF; border:1px #999 solid; padding:3px; width:260px; font-size:13px;}
#contact_us a { float:left;}
#contact_us img { float:left;}
#contact_us .sub2 { padding:5px 15px; background-color:#3399CC; color:#FFFFFF; font-weight:bold; font:13px; border:none; margin:10px 0px; cursor:pointer;}
#contact_us .sub2:hover { background:#FF3300;}


.autocomplete{display:block;background:#FFFFFF;z-index:100000;border:1px #0099CC solid;border-top:none;filter:alpha(opacity=95);opacity:0.95;height:150px;overflow:auto;}
.autocomplete li{cursor:pointer;background-image:none!important;font-size:14px!important;margin:0;padding:2px 5px;}
.autocomplete li:hover,.autocomplete li.sfhover{background:#c7e7fd;}
.autocomplete .selected{background:#c7e7fd;}


/* error_message */
.error_message { color:#333333!important; width:860px; min-height:200px;}
.error_message .left_ads { float:right; list-style-type:none!important; position:relative; top:-100px;}
.error_message .left_ads li {padding:10px 0px; }
.error_message .left_ads li a{ color:#333333!important; font-size:13px; font-weight:bold; }
.error_message .left_ads li a p { font-size:13px;}
.error_message ul { width:500px; float:left; list-style-type:none!important; padding-left:10px;}
